OpenCores
URL https://opencores.org/ocsvn/phr/phr/trunk

Subversion Repositories phr

[/] [phr/] [trunk/] [doc/] [references/] [JTAG-doc/] [FTDI/] [AN_108_traduccion.txt] - Rev 248

Go to most recent revision | Compare with Previous | Blame | View Log

Los dispositivos FT2232D, FT232H, FT2232H y el FT4232H incoporan un procesador comandado llamado "Multi-Protocol Synchronous Serial Engine (MPSSE). EL propósito del procesador de comandado MPSSE es comunicarse con dispisitivos que usan protocolos sincronos (tal como JTAG oSPI) en una manera eficiente.
La unidad MPSSE es controlada utilizando un comando SETUP. Varios comandos son utilizados para sacar y entrar datos de clock del chip, así como controlar otras lineas de I/O.
Si está desactivado el MPSSE se lleva a cavo un reseteo y no tendrá ningún efecto en el resto de el chip. Cuando está activo, este tomará sus comandos y datos desde el dato OUT escritó hacia el conducto OUT en el chip.
Esto se hace simplemente utilizando el comando WRITE, como si el dato estuviera escribiendose en un puerto COM.
Cualquier lectura de se pasará de nuevo en el conducto normal IN. Esto se hace usando el comando normal READ, como si el dato estuviera leyendose desde un puerto COM.

Para asegurar que el controlador del dispositivo no emitirá respuesta IN si el baffer es deshabilitado para aceptar datos, agregar una llamada a la prioridad FT_SetFlowcontrol para entrada al modo MPSSE o MCU Host Bus.

Go to most recent revision | Compare with Previous | Blame | View Log

powered by: WebSVN 2.1.0

© copyright 1999-2024 O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.